  1. After holding the ball, the goalkeeper pulls his hands backward to slow down the rate of change of momentum while increasing the time.
  2. The force is directly related to the rate of change of momentum, this allows less force to be exerted on his hands if he moves his hands backward.
  3. According to newton's second law, the rate of change of momentum of a body is equal to the force applied to the body.
